Possible Causes of Water Damage in Charleston Homes and Businesses

Water damage in Charleston can happen unexpectedly, often due to heavy rainstorms or hurricanes that overwhelm drainage systems. These weather events are common in the area and can lead to flooding that seeps into basements, crawl spaces, and ground floors. Additionally, aging plumbing systems or faulty appliances may develop leaks over time, causing hidden water damage behind walls or under flooring. Recognizing the cause of water intrusion is essential for effective restoration and preventing future issues.

Another frequent cause of water damage in Charleston is sewer backups, which can occur during heavy storms when municipal systems become overloaded. Poor drainage or clogging can result in contaminated water flooding living spaces, posing health risks. Structural issues like roof leaks or burst pipes also contribute to water infiltration in residential and commercial properties. Addressing these root causes promptly is vital to minimize damage and avoid costly repairs down the line.

How Our Water Damage Restoration Team Fixes Your Property

When you contact our team, the first step is a thorough inspection to assess the extent of the water damage. We use advanced moisture detection tools to identify hidden areas affected by water intrusion. This allows us to develop a precise restoration plan tailored specifically to your property. Our experts then proceed with water extraction, removing standing water efficiently to prevent further deterioration.

Once the excess water is removed, we focus on drying and dehumidifying the affected areas. Our professional equipment accelerates the drying process, helping to reduce mold growth and structural damage. We continually monitor moisture levels to ensure that all affected zones are thoroughly dried. Additionally, we sanitize and deodorize to eliminate any bacteria or mold spores, restoring a clean and healthy environment.

Restoring your property also involves repairing or replacing damaged building materials such as drywall, flooring, and insulation.
